Description

Simple sand blasting device
Technical Field
The utility model relates to an apparatus technical field for the artificial tooth specifically is a simple and easy sand blasting unit.
Background
The denture is a general term of a prosthesis made after partial or all of upper and lower teeth are lost, and the denture after sand blasting needs to be carried out on a technician table through a sand blaster during production, so that the denture after sand blasting has good whitening performance.
The Chinese patent discloses a simple sand blasting device (with an authorization publication number of CN 205415346U), which is characterized in that a glass cover body is arranged on a technician table, a handheld sand blaster is arranged in the glass cover body, so that an operator can operate in the glass cover body, and a glass layer is arranged between the operator and the handheld sand blaster to prevent the operator from sucking powder; and handheld sandblaster connects dress sand blaster, dress sand blaster connection air pump, and operating personnel can control the sandblast volume at any time, improves the convenience of operation, improves work efficiency and promotion operating mass, but, this patent can't carry out recovery processing to the sweeps that the sandblast in-process produced to also can't press from both sides the tight rotation with the artificial tooth, so not only can increase staff intensity of labour, also can reduce work efficiency. 2. The simple sand blasting device as claimed in claim 1, wherein the springs (10) are symmetrically arranged inside the placing holes (22), and one end of each spring (10) is connected with a clamping plate (9).
3. The simple sand blasting device as claimed in claim 1, wherein a rotating groove (15) is formed in the fixing rod (6), a mounting sleeve (12) is arranged at the tail end of the rotating rod (11) in the rotating groove (15), and a motor (13) is arranged in the rotating groove (15).
4. The simple sand blasting device as claimed in claim 3, wherein a rotating shaft (14) is connected to the driving end of the motor (13), the top end of the rotating shaft (14) is embedded into the mounting sleeve (12), and bolts are symmetrically arranged on the outer portion of the mounting sleeve (12).
5. The simple sand blasting device as claimed in claim 1, wherein the filter screen (20) is symmetrically provided with mounting blocks (17) at the outer sides of both sides, and the recovery tank (21) is provided with mounting grooves (18) matched with the mounting blocks (17) at the inner side.
6. The simple sand blasting device as claimed in claim 1, wherein sliding plates (19) are symmetrically arranged on the lower surface of the recovery box (16), and sliding grooves which slide with the sliding plates (19) are formed in the sand blasting machine main body (2).
7. The simple sand blasting device as claimed in claim 1, wherein the filter screen (20) is arranged at one third of the position from top to bottom inside the recovery tank (21), and a handle groove is opened at one side of the recovery box (16).
